ВС:Бухгалтерия 6.3 Печенье с предсказаниями fortune-cookies ru п... (от Печенье с предсказаниями)
История с замедлением веб-приложений в iOS получила неожиданное продолжение
Совсем недавно мы писали о возмущении независимых разработчиков, которые обнаружили, что веб-приложения при запуске из основного экрана работают медленнее, чем из основного браузера. Из-за такого замедления приложения, распространяемые через AppStore, получают несправедливое преимущество. Как выяснилось, при запуске веб-приложений с основного экрана используется особая технология просмотра веб-контента. К сожалению, эта технология, до сих пор применяемая в самой современной версии iOS 4.3, не использует все
преимущества, которые реализованы в новейшей версии основного веб-браузера. По нескольким оценкам, скорость исполнения веб-приложений падает приблизительно в два раза – это хорошо согласуется с версией Apple –
интерпретатор скриптов Nitro в мобильном варианте Safari 4.3 работает как раз вдвое быстрее, чем в iOS 4.2.
В свете признания компании Apple особого внимания заслуживают результаты новых тестов. Аналитическая компания Blaze провела сравнительные испытания двух популярных аппаратов, конкурирующих аппаратов – Nexus S на базе операционной системы Android и iPhone 4 на платформе iOS 4.3. В ходе теста выяснилось, что для реального набора
веб-сайтов Android-аппарат оказался значительно быстрее в исполнении JavaScript-сценариев и в отображении веб-страниц.
Представители Blaze заявили, что их методика сравнительных испытаний более достоверна, чем синтетический тест SunSpider. В ходе исследования специалисты измеряли время загрузки веб-сайтов, принадлежащих 1000
крупнейших компаний в мире, через беспроводную сеть WiFi. В 84% случаев аппарат Nexus S загружал веб-сайты быстрее своего конкурента. Среднее время загрузки главной страницы веб-сайта для iPhone 4 с системой iOS 4.3 составило 3,254 секунды, а вот у аппарата Nexus S – всего 2,144 секунды.
С мобильными сайтами ситуация сложилась по-другому. Из 1000 испытанных сайтов 175 предлагали мобильную версию — аппарат iPhone смог загрузить эти сайты со средним временем 2,085 секунд, а средний показатель Nexus S составил 2,024 секунды. Формально аппарат Nexus S оказался на 3% быстрее, но сами представители Blaze признают, что время загрузки было практически одинаковым.
После публикации исследований Blaze разразился еще один скандал – оказывается, авторы исследования применяли для тестирования не фирменный браузер Safari, а собственное приложение, специально написанное для этого случая. Кроме того, компания Apple заявила, что
результаты тестов Blaze ни в коем случае нельзя относить к браузеру Safari, поскольку для отображения в сторонних приложениях на платформе iOS 4.3 используется та самая злополучная технология веб-просмотра, которая не может использовать все оптимизации, доступные браузеру Safari. Косвенно
аргументы Applt еще раз подтверждают, что сторонние веб-приложения будут медленнее работать, если не запускаются из-под браузера Safari.
Оставьте Ваш комментарий или мнение о новости: История с замедлением веб-приложений в iOS получила неожиданное продолжение Просим Вас оставлять сообщения по теме и уважать своих собеседников и авторов новостного сообщения.